Until now, if we examined an EPT fault and the corresponding guest physical memory was not allocated, we forwarded the faulting instruction to the instruction emulator, which in turn handled the memory allocation implicitly. This lead to long instruction emulation times on certain instructions (e.g. 'rep mov' on large memory junks). Therefore, we now allocate and map the corresponding guest physical memory immediately in the EPT fault handler and directly return to the guest. fixes #2645
